WebA: COVID-19 vaccines can cause mild side effects, such as pain, redness or swelling where the shot was given, fever, fatigue, headache, chills and muscle or joint pain. These side effects are normal and signs that your immune system is building protection against the virus. Most side effects occur within the first three days of vaccination and ...
